In vitro cytotoxicity of zinc oxide, iron oxide and copper nanopowders prepared by green synthesis
چکیده انگلیسی


- In vitro cyototoxicity of green synthesized copper, iron oxide and zinc oxide nanopowders were assessed.
- Vero, PK 15 and MDBK cells used for in vitro study for nanopowders use in animal applications.
- Effect of various concentrations (10-50 μg/100 μl) and exposure time of nanopowders were evaluated in the current study.
- It suggested that the activity of green synthesized NPs were highly dependent on concentration, exposure time and type of cells.
- Present study revealed that the all the three selected metallic nanoparticles were found non-toxic.
- The synthesized nanoparticles may be used for in vivo application.

In vitro cytotoxic effects of ZnO, FeO and Cu metallic nanopowders (NPs) on Vero (African green monkey kidney cell line), PK 15 (Pig kidney cell line) and Madin Darby Bovine Kidney (MDBK) cell lines were investigated at different time intervals (24 and 48 h). MTT (3-(4,5-dimethylthiazol-2-yl)-2,5-diphenyltetrazolium bromide) assay was used to determine the cytotoxic effects of green synthesized (plant based) nanopowders. The comparative effects of exposure period and concentration of nanopowders on cell viability were studied. Green synthesized nanopowders showed varying activity on different type of cells and the effect was generally based on the concentration and exposure time. In MDBK cells, only ZnO nanopowder (NP) showed significant effect on cell viability. The ZnO NP showed improved cell viability at lower concentration (10 μg/100 μl) in all type of cells (Vero, PK 15 and MDBK cells). In contrast, FeO NP showed better activity at the concentration of 10 μg/100 μl, 50 μg/100 μl and 40 μg/100 μl after 24 h exposure time in Vero, PK 15 and MDBK cells respectively. However better cell viability was observed in Cu NP treated Vero, PK 15 and MDBK cells at 40 μg/100 μl, 20 μg/100 μl and 10 μg/100 μl correspondingly. These studies suggested that the activity of green synthesized NPs were highly dependent on concentration, exposure time and type of cells.
